Output fb26e8676a423fe5ec3ada9d11a90dfeb4397120acc6db8e66e9db9d4e56dbbc:6

value
76145183
script pubkey
OP_0 OP_PUSHBYTES_20 c3e259ebba42fc69e0b605b21534de81d0813e80
address
ltc1qc039n6a6gt7xnc9kqkep2dx7s8ggz05qzrrx0n
transaction
fb26e8676a423fe5ec3ada9d11a90dfeb4397120acc6db8e66e9db9d4e56dbbc
spent
true